Carebase is an independent group of care homes for the elderly located throughout southeast England. Residential, nursing, and dementia care of the highest standard is provided in purpose-built accommodation.

Since purchasing its first care home in 1990, Carebase have grown and the company bases its values on courtesy and service to residents, relatives, staff and suppliers. The focus is on providing high standards of accommodation in homes and high service standards as a company. The company's belief in their staff and a commitment to training and development has ensured that the team of staff are professional and above all, caring.

Costs for care homes owned by Carebase Ltd

Average costs per week for care homes owned by Carebase Ltd by care type provided. The weekly fees are calculated using the starting price for self-funded care provided by Carebase Ltd, based on 4 out of 13 settings.

Type of Care Provided Average Weekly Cost
Residential Care £1,547
Residential Dementia Care £1,635
Nursing Care £1,547
Nursing Dementia Care £1,635
All Care Types £1,635
Keep in mind that fees can vary between providers and factors such as specific needs, location, room type and more can affect costs. For more information on care home fees across the UK and advice on how to pay, see our care home fees guide.
